Dolariya Population - Dohad, Gujarat

Dolariya is a medium size village located in Dhanpur Taluka of Dohad district, Gujarat with total 113 families residing. The Dolariya village has population of 851 of which 440 are males while 411 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Dolariya village population of children with age 0-6 is 176 which makes up 20.68 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Dolariya village is 934 which is higher than Gujarat state average of 919. Child Sex Ratio for the Dolariya as per census is 833, lower than Gujarat average of 890.

Dolariya village has lower literacy rate compared to Gujarat. In 2011, literacy rate of Dolariya village was 56.89 % compared to 78.03 % of Gujarat. In Dolariya Male literacy stands at 71.80 % while female literacy rate was 41.39 %.

Caste Factor

In Dolariya village, most of the village population is from Schedule Tribe (ST). Schedule Tribe (ST) constitutes 97.88 % while Schedule Caste (SC) were 0.59 % of total population in Dolariya village.

Work Profile

In Dolariya village out of total population, 394 were engaged in work activities. 77.66 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 22.34 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 394 workers engaged in Main Work, 283 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 10 were Agricultural labourer.
